Michael Fish's NBC26 Storm Shield weather forecast
Today, an area of low pressure will be approaching bringing a small chance of a morning shower, then a little better chance of scattered showers or a rumble of thunder mainly later this afternoon. With more cloudiness and a vigorous a easterly breeze, we won't get very warm with highs in the low/mid 70s and cooler readings along Lake Michigan. As this low pressure passes through tonight, we'll have areas of rain or a T'storm moving through. Lows will be around 60. Wednesday might start with a stray morning shower, but then the sun will come back with highs in the upper-70s, though cooler readings lakeside. Wednesday night should be quiet with mostly clear skies and lows in the mid-60s. Here comes the heat and humidity for Thursday with highs in the upper-80s. Get ready for the 90s in the forecast starting Friday, into the weekend.
